Saint Jean Baptiste

de Grenelle

23, place Etienne-Pernet, 75015 Paris Orgue de la Crypte La chapelle Saint-Etienne OdT>
1981 - Rémy Mahler (1)

II/7 - traction mécanique

E1 This is a ssmall instrument (Opus 0) built by Rémy Mahler of Pfaffenhoffen (67) in 1981. It was initially situated at a private person in Dorlisheim (67) and transferred to the crypt/the chapel Saint- Etienne of St Jean Baptiste de Grenelle in 2015. Lire plus Photos : Victor Weller
Composition 1er clavier (54 notes) Bourdon 8’ S Prestant 4’ Nazard 2’2/3 Doublette 2’ Mixture III rgs 2ème Clavier (54 notes) Bourdon 8’ Larigot 1’1/3 Pédalier (30 notes) Soubasse 16’ (prévu) Tirasse I - Tirasse II - Accouplement II/I
